The 100x150mm Nano IR Hard Graduated Neutral Density Filter – ND8 (0.9) – 3 Stop is a rectangular filter that helps to darken specific areas of an image, such as bright skies while allowing for a normal, unaffected exposure in the other regions of the image. The filter is densest at the edge and tapers to clear by the middle, with a hard-edged line of transition between the dense and clear areas. Hard-edged GNDs have a sudden transition from dark to clear. The NiSi 100mm filter system is great for cameras with lenses that have a standard filter thread from 49mm to 95mm.
Made from High-quality Optical Glass
NiSi GND filters do not affect the coloration of the image, offer a true to life color, and are made from high-quality optical glass (not resin) with nano coating to prevent losing any single bit of detail. By using a neutral density filter the camera is vulnerable to infrared light which will cast the unwanted red color to the photos when shooting at a small aperture. NiSi GND filters have an infrared protection coating layer to eliminate the infrared light through the lens to bring back the natural true to life color.
Ideal Shooting Scenes
This type of filter is most appropriate for scenes that have a sudden transition from the foreground to the sky. Most commonly, this would include landscapes with no elements protruding above the horizon such as a seascape looking toward the open ocean. They can be used shooting into the direct light where a sharp transition is needed. When used shooting away from the light, they can produce very moody and dramatic skies. Avoid using them where elements protrude above the horizon since those elements will appear very dark above the transition line in your image.
